The Certificate in Multisensory Language Development for Blind Children is a crucial course for educators and professionals working with visually impaired students. This program emphasizes the importance of a multisensory approach to language development, providing learners with the skills to create inclusive and effective learning environments.

About this course

With the increasing demand for inclusivity and accessibility in education, this course is essential for career advancement in the field. It equips learners with evidence-based strategies and techniques to help blind children reach their full potential in language and literacy skills. By completing this course, professionals can enhance their expertise, broaden their career opportunities, and make a significant impact on the lives of blind students. The course covers various topics, including braille literacy, tactile graphics, auditory skills, and technology for the visually impaired. By integrating these skills into their teaching practice, educators can create engaging and accessible learning experiences for all students.

Course Details


• Multisensory Learning Techniques
• Braille and Tactile Reading Strategies
• Auditory Language Development for Blind Children
• Using Assistive Technology in Language Instruction
• Teaching Literacy Skills to Blind Children
• Phonemic Awareness and Phonics Instruction for Blind Students
• Developing Vocabulary and Comprehension Skills in Blind Learners
• Assessing Language Development in Blind Children
• Creating Accessible Learning Materials for Blind Students
• Best Practices in Multisensory Language Instruction for Blind Children
